PROCESS FOR PRODUCTION OF RED GINSENG HYDROLYSIS CONCENTRATE HAVING ENRICHED SPECIFIC COMPONENT

A method for production of red ginseng hydrolysis concentrate according to an embodiment of the present disclosure includes carrying out an enzyme reaction of red ginseng concentrate by adding an enzyme solution followed by addition of alcohol to prepare a mixture solution of red ginseng and alcohol, and centrifuging the prepared mixture solution of red ginseng and alcohol followed by concentration under reduced pressure of a supernatant separated by the centrifuge, and a red ginseng hydrolysis concentrate produced by the aforementioned process.

Method of treating a skin wound with a liquid-state topical pharmaceutical composition
11571452 · 2023-02-07 ·

The invention generally relates to a liquid topical pharmaceutical composition used in treating various skin wounds. The composition is characterized by strong moisture absorption and retention capabilities and being able to quickly seal the wound. The composition can resist oxidation, effectively inhibit bacteria and sterilization, protect germinal cells from further damage, eliminate wound swelling and promote wound healing. The pharmaceutical composition can be widely used in the treatment of burn, skin abrasion, laceration, infectious skin ulcer and wound exposure, save dressing and be used in a convenient and highly effective way.

Intact Pea Protein-Based Nutrient Composition

The present invention discloses a nutritional composition and method of using and making the nutritional composition. The nutritional composition is an intact pea protein based nutrient composition for use in both enteral and oral feeding, and provides a nonallergenic diet for providing optimal nutrition to users. The nutritional composition is made from organic and plant-based ingredients. The nutritional composition has pea protein, phytochemical extracts, fatty acids, organic ingredients free of the top eight allergens and corn, and prebiotic fiber. The nutritional composition is provided in liquid form for enteral and/or oral feeding.

Pharmaceutical Composition for Treating Oral Ulcer and Preparation Method and Application Thereof
20230072566 · 2023-03-09 ·

A pharmaceutical composition for treating oral ulcer, a preparation method and an application thereof are provided, which belong to the technical field of pharmaceutical compositions. The pharmaceutical composition includes the following raw materials: 20-50 parts of Sanhuang mixture, 15-20 parts of lotus root powder, 30-50 parts of Galla chinensis, 10-20 parts of Lonicera japonica Thunb., 10-20 parts of vanilla bean, 10-20 parts of propolis, 5-8 parts of oak bark, 5-10 parts of tea, 3-5 parts of Asarum, 1-2 parts of Atractylodes macrocephala and 5-30 parts of chlorhexidine acetate. The pharmaceutical composition for treating oral ulcer has the efficacies of clearing away heat, detoxifying removing blood stasis and reducing swelling, promoting granulation and relieving pain, inhibiting bacteria and killing bacteria, and has the advantages of quick response, easy finding of raw materials and low cost, and has a good therapeutic effect for treating oral ulcer clinically.
